Preliminary Review and Match Prediction for Merida vs Alaves

Merida

Merida advanced from the previous stage with a penalty win against Utebo FC after a full time 2-2 draw. Since the game, Merida have only lost one game and drew one while winning the rest. They will get a test against Alaves on Wednesday as they eye advancing into the next stage where they could face either Eldense or Burgos CF.

Alaves

Having lost their last three games in their local league, Alaves face a major test in a very troubling time and will try to turn their fortune after winning just one match since their victory against Lleida in the Copa Del Rey back in the early days of November 2022.

Merida vs Alaves Team News

With the World Cup just concluded and all players from both sides in very good conditions, both teams have full squads to choose from.

Merida vs Alaves Probable Lineups

Merida: Montoya; Felipe, Nacho, Bonaque, Ramon; Acosta, Rodriguez, Melendez; Larrubia, Lolo, Mukai.

Alaves: Sivera; Duarte, Abqar, Laguardiia, Arroyo; Rebbach, Sediar, Sevilla, Rioja; de la Fuente, Guridi.
